How do i remove dog urine from my carpet?

Dog urine can cause permanent damage to your carpet if not cleaned up properly. The first step is to blot up as much of the urine as possible with a clean, dry cloth. Next, mix one cup of white vinegar with one cup of water and apply it to the stain with a sponge. Let the mixture soak into the stain for five minutes, then blot it up with a clean cloth. Finally, rinse the area with cold water and blot it dry.

Can old pet urine stains be removed from carpet

Hydrogen peroxide is a great way to get rid of old urine stains on your carpet. Simply mix it with water at a 1:4 ratio and spritz it on the stain. Leave it to work for 10 minutes, then blot it up with a cloth. Allow the carpet to dry naturally.

Does vinegar get rid of urine smell in carpet

If your rug or carpet smells like urine, vinegar may be able to help neutralize the odor. Blot the area dry, then pour a vinegar solution on the affected area. Let the solution soak for 10 minutes to reach the deepest fibers in the rug. Use paper towels to blot and dry the vinegar solution.

The warm, acid state of urine is the perfect breeding ground for bacteria. Bacteria will begin to flourish almost immediately in this state. The urine will start to oxidize and react with the carpet, which will create a permanent color change if the urine is not removed immediately.

How do you remove set in urine stains?

Vinegar is an excellent urine stain remover. To remove a urine stain, soak the area in vinegar for a few minutes, then rinse with cold water. Repeat if necessary. If the stain is still there, try soaking the area in a solution of 1 part vinegar to 2 parts water, then rinse with cold water.

Urine is composed of many different chemicals, which can interact with dyes in carpeting, leading to staining. The extent of the stain will depend on the composition of the urine, the dyes used in the carpet, and any treatments that were applied to the carpet during manufacturing. In some cases, the stain may be permanent.
